figcaption {
  color: #6c757d;
}

/* Bootstrap-style callout panels */
.callout {
  border: 1px solid;
  border-radius: 1rem;
  margin: 1.5rem 0;
  overflow: hidden;
}

.callout-title {
  font-weight: 600;
  font-size: 1.4rem;
  padding: 0.75rem 1rem;
  margin: 0;
}

.callout-body {
  background-color: #fff;
  padding: 0.75rem 1rem;
  color: #212529;
}

.callout-body p:first-child {
  margin-top: 0;
}

.callout-body p:last-child {
  margin-bottom: 0;
}

.callout-icon {
  color: inherit;
}

/* Note / Info — blue */
.callout-note,
.callout-info {
  border-color: #b8d4f5;
}
.callout-note .callout-title,
.callout-info .callout-title {
  background-color: #ddeeff;
  color: #1a4f8a;
}

/* Tip — green */
.callout-tip {
  border-color: #aedcbe;
}
.callout-tip .callout-title {
  background-color: #d4edda;
  color: #1a5c35;
}

/* Important — purple */
.callout-important {
  border-color: #c9b8e8;
}
.callout-important .callout-title {
  background-color: #e8e0f5;
  color: #4a2a8a;
}

/* Warning — yellow */
.callout-warning {
  border-color: #ffe08a;
}
.callout-warning .callout-title {
  background-color: #fff3cd;
  color: #7a5800;
}

/* Caution — red */
.callout-caution {
  border-color: #f5b8be;
}
.callout-caution .callout-title {
  background-color: #fde0e3;
  color: #8a1a24;
}
